fakeAsync

function

npm Package @angular/core
Module import { fakeAsync } from '@angular/core/testing';
Source core/testing/src/fake_async.ts

function fakeAsync(fn: Function): (...args: any[]) => any;

Description

Wraps a function to be executed in the fakeAsync zone:

  • microtasks are manually executed by calling flushMicrotasks(),
  • timers are synchronous, tick() simulates the asynchronous passage of time.

If there are any pending timers at the end of the function, an exception will be thrown.

Can be used to wrap inject() calls.

Example

describe('this test', () => {
  it('looks async but is synchronous', <any>fakeAsync((): void => {
       let flag = false;
       setTimeout(() => { flag = true; }, 100);
       expect(flag).toBe(false);
       tick(50);
       expect(flag).toBe(false);
       tick(50);
       expect(flag).toBe(true);
     }));
});
